일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
- ios
- swift documentation
- 클린 코드
- Human interface guide
- collectionview
- Protocol
- 스위프트
- Clean Code
- SWIFT
- swiftUI
- combine
- 리펙토링
- Refactoring
- uitableview
- clean architecture
- RxCocoa
- Observable
- UICollectionView
- MVVM
- UITextView
- uiscrollview
- map
- HIG
- 애니메이션
- Xcode
- rxswift
- ribs
- 리팩토링
- 리펙터링
- tableView
- Today
- Total
목록Provisioning Profile (5)
김종권의 iOS 앱 개발 알아가기
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/ZLMPi/btrPFzrr5iw/l67Wol3n9pkizFHv7RgU20/img.png)
Fastlane match란? Certificate, Provisioning Profile을 특정 git 레포에 저장해놓고 개발자들 사이 or ci/cd 때 쉽게 관리할 수 있는 기능 mathc명령어를 통해 terminal에서 Apple 개발자 사이트에 접속하여 Certificate 만들기도 가능 Certificate를 만들고 Provisioning Profile 생성도 같이 지정해둔 git repo에 저장하고 끌어다 쓰기가 가능 사용 방법 팀 내 개발자 대표자 한명은 match를 통해 certificate를 새로 만들어서 git repo에 저장 (Certs, Profiles 내용 생성) 팀 개발자들은 match 명령어를 통해 certs, profiles 정보를 땡겨와서 Xcode에 세팅 (이때 팀 개발..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/clikXA/btrMIekWfCm/UcHoDrVNa9KQlIJ8LChNj1/img.png)
1. 위젯 Widget 사용 방법 - WidgetKit, WidgetFamily 2. 위젯 Widget 사용 방법 - API 데이터 로드와 위젯UI 업데이트 3. 위젯 Widget 사용 방법 - 위젯 딥링크 구현 방법 (widgetURL, scenePhase, sheet) 4. 위젯 Widget 사용 방법 - 위젯 이미지 로드 방법 5. 위젯 Widget 사용 방법 - Provisioning Profile 등록 (WidgetExtension) Provisioning Profile 등록 과정 Xcode에서 WidgetExtension 번들 아이디 확인 Apple Developer에서 ID 생성 + 버튼 클릭 App IDs 클릭 > 생성 Provisioning Profile 2개 생성 iOS App Deve..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/bCs5LY/btroVkHbL8i/GiyKqftW4e87TL4fQQJYa1/img.gif)
1. iCloud, CloudKit 사용 방법 - Xcode, Profiles 세팅 2. iCloud, CloudKit 사용 방법 - CloudKit Console 세팅 3. iCloud, CloudKit 사용 방법 - CloudKit 연동 (불러오기, 생성, 삭제, 업데이트) * 주의: iCloud, CloudKit 사용 방법 - Xcode, Profiles 세팅의 예제 코드에서 Bundle Identifier가 com.jake.ExiCloud에이었지만, 아래부터 com.jake.ExiCloud으로 변경 Console 접속, Container 선택 CloudKit Console 클릭 CloudKit DataBase 선택 Container 선택 - cloud.{bundle Identifier} Recor..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/kYnCP/btroRdQf2cs/2m5ovk0Pc3k0p2yVdeSUKK/img.gif)
1. iCloud, CloudKit, 사용 방법 - Xcode, Profiles 세팅 2. iCloud, CloudKit, 사용 방법 - CloudKit Console 세팅 3. iCloud, CloudKit 사용 방법 - CloudKit 연동 (불러오기, 생성, 삭제, 업데이트) CloudKit을 사용하기 위한 Xcode 세팅 Host in CloudKit 체크 만약 기존 Xcode 프로젝트를 만들때 체크하지 않았다면, 이곳을 참고하여 CoreData 설정하고 Cloud 설정 참고 CloudKit을 사용하기 위한 저장소 iCloud Container 생성 CloudKit을 사용하려면, iCloud 동기화 때문에 Provisioning Profiles이 먼저 준비되어 있어야 사용 가능하므로 준비 필요 A..
![](http://i1.daumcdn.net/thumb/C150x150/?fname=https://blog.kakaocdn.net/dn/buXlas/btqOxsVfBzh/nI57vQNxVIrdPd3kYFdOW0/img.png)
-개념: ios-development.tistory.com/246 Certificates 생성 및 실행하여 xcode에 등록 AppID 등록 Device 등록 Provisioning Profiles 등록 +버튼 클릭 iOS App Distribution (xcode에서 debug용)과 Ad Hoc (내부 테스터에게 배포용) 각각 체크하여 생성 AppID에서 적용할 앱 선택 Certificate 선택 적용할 테스터 디바이스 선택 Name입력 후 Generate Name은 주로 "dev_appName", "adhoc_appName"이런 식으로 작성 Download 저장 Xcode에 위에서 받은 Provisioning Profile 등록 Automatically manage signing 해제 Debug, R..